In 1987 and 1993 Lovaas and colleagues published articles describing the recovery of almost 50 of a group of very young children with autism treated intensively with applied behavioral analysis for several years Lovaas 1987. He reported that 47 of his cohort receiving intensive behavioral intervention were mainstreamed in first grade and had IQs in the normal range. Lovaas Therapy The popularity of the term Lovaas Therapy grew out of the Young Autism Project which began in 1970 and through the publication of project results in 1987 by Lovaas. To date no one has replicated the findings of the 1987 study without treatment intensity approaching 40 hours per week of structured intervention.
